LD10CS高强铝合金脉冲MIG焊工艺研究 被引量:4

Pulse MIG welding process of LD10CS high strength aluminum alloy

摘要 研究单、双脉冲MIG焊工艺对LD10CS高强铝合金焊接接头组织及力学性能的影响。实验结果表明,单脉冲MIG焊时,焊缝成形较差,焊接变形量大;而双脉冲MIG焊时,焊缝表面呈现清晰的鱼鳞纹状、焊接变形明显减小。双脉冲MIG焊与单脉冲MIG焊相比,焊缝组织明显细化,焊接接头的力学性能得到提高。 The effects of single pulse and double pulse MIG welding process on the microstructures and mechanical properties of the weld joints in LD10CS high strength aluminum alloy are investigated.The results show that the appearance of weld is worse and the deformation is bigger in single pulse MIG welding process.The weht snrface appears distinct fish-scale patterns and the deformation decreasesobviously in double pulse MIG welding process.Comparing with single pulse MIG welding.the microstructure of double pulse MIG welding is refined and the mechanical property of wehled joint is improved.
